Output 18892823af7b2634718c595f63b0e17fad6bbadc05ec6bbd1a8066d2300d77c4:8

value
2150595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a46fb717cc44b15f568f81ab8ac9b3363a8f3d14 OP_EQUAL
address
3GgUa7V2NJFRtHqHZ1d4u9ZMqW1nxE6ui5
transaction
18892823af7b2634718c595f63b0e17fad6bbadc05ec6bbd1a8066d2300d77c4
confirmations
264353
spent
true